Tutorial Cara Install DNS di Ubuntu

Senin | komentar

Tutorial Cara Install DNS di Ubuntu - Postingan kali ini saya ingin berbagi bagaimana Tutorial Cara Install DNS di Ubuntu, mungkin sudah banyak blog/website yang menulis artikel yang sama namun saya coba berbagi untuk tutorial ini. Pertama apakah DNS itu ? Domain Name System (DNS) adalah distribute database system yang digunakan untuk pencarian nama komputer (name resolution) di jaringan yang mengunakan TCP/IP (Transmission Control Protocol/Internet Protocol). DNS biasa digunakan pada aplikasi yang terhubung ke Internet seperti web browser atau e-mail, dimana DNS membantu memetakan host name sebuah komputer ke IP address ataupun sebaliknya.



Package yan perlu di install untuk konfigurasi DNS di ubuntu adalah 'bind9', BIND merupakan salah satu implementasi dari DNS yang paling banyak digunakan pada server di Internet. Implementasi DNS pertama adalah JEEVES buatan Paul Mockapetris. BIND dibuat untuk sistem operasi BSD UNIX 4.3 oleh Kevin Dunlap, tapi kemudian banyak di-porting ke banyak turunan UNIX termasuk Linux.

- Langkah pertama adalah install package 'bind9' dengan cara :
apt-get install bind9
Pada tutorial ini saya mencoba menggunakan konfigurasi sebagai berikut :


  • Nama domain : catatanblogkecil.com
  • Nama hostname : server.catatanblogkecil.com
  • IP Address Server : 192.168.10.18


- Buat zona baru untuk catatanblogkecil.com pada file named.

  • cd /etc/bind
  • nano named.conf

kemudian tambahkan baris konfigurasi berikut pada bagian paling bawah:
zone "catatanblogkecil.com" {
type master;
file "/etc/bind/db.catatanblogkecil.com";
};
- Langkah selanjutnya adalah membuat konfigurasi zona forward untuk catatanblogkecil.com. Untuk memudahkan konfigurasi, copy file db.local menjadi db.catatanblogkecil.com

  • cp db.local db.vavai.com

- Lakukan pengubahan pada file db.catatanblogkecil.com


  • nano db.catatanblogkecil.com

Ubah konfigurasinya sehingga menjadi:

$TTL    604800
@       IN      SOA     ns1.catatanblogkecil.com. root.catatanblogkecil.com. (
                     2011062700         ; Serial
                         604800         ; Refresh
                          86400         ; Retry
                        2419200         ; Expire
                         604800 )       ; Negative Cache TTL
;
@       IN      NS      ns1.catatanblogkecil.com.
@       IN      A       192.168.10.18
ns1     IN      A       192.168.10.18
server    IN      A       192.168.10.18

- Restart service dns dengan menggunakan perintah:

  • /etc/init.d/bind9 restart

Untuk melakukan testing DNS, kita bisa menggunakan perintah host namadomain, misalnya host catatanblogkecil.com atau menggunakan perintah nslookup sebagai berikut :

root@server:~# nslookup catatanblogkecil.com
Server: 192.168.10.18
Address: 192.168.10.18#53Name: catatanblogkecil.com
Address: 192.168.10.18

Perhatikan jawaban dari hasil nslookup, pastikan bahwa IP yang muncul adalah IP server yang disetup DNS servernya.

Demikian tutorial kali ini yang dapat saya bagikan. Semoga bermanfaat untuk semuanya khususnya untuk saya pribadi. Terima kasih :D



Written by: Ridwan Nulloh
Catatan Kecil, Updated at: 22.58
 
Support : Creating Website | Johny Template | Mas Template
Copyright © 2011. Catatan Kecil - All Rights Reserved
Template Created by Creating Website Published by Mas Template
Proudly powered by Blogger